About Kooltra
Kooltra is a Canadian fintech company building FX infrastructure and cross-border payment technology for banks and financial institutions. With over a decade in market and a growing footprint in North America, we are now accelerating our US expansion and undertaking a fundamental shift toward an AI-first development and delivery model.
To fuel that shift, we need Platform Engineers to invest in our platform and transform how we implement customers.
